What Is Google’s Search Generative Experience (SGE)?

SGE is Google’s latest integration of AI into search. It uses generative AI to answer complex queries with summarized, conversational responses. These summaries often appear above organic search results, which means they can capture attention before users even scroll.

For example, someone searching “Best digital marketing agency in Coral Gables for lawyers” might see a brief summary that pulls insights from agency websites, reviews, and articles—sometimes without clicking anything at all.

If your website content isn’t designed to feed into these AI summaries, you risk becoming invisible—even if you rank on page one.

How SGE Is Impacting Miami SEO in 2025

  • Fewer Clicks, More Skimming
    With AI answers at the top, users are clicking fewer links. That means your site’s value needs to be visible within the SGE snapshot itself.
  • The Rise of “Answer-Oriented” Content
    Google is prioritizing concise, helpful responses. Businesses must write content that clearly answers specific questions, includes structured data, and reflects real experience.
  • Authority and Trustworthiness Matter More Than Ever
    SGE leans on websites with strong E-E-A-T: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, and Trustworthiness. This is especially important for “Your Money or Your Life” (YMYL) content—such as law, healthcare, or financial advice, which is common in the Miami market.

Key Strategies for Miami Businesses to Adapt

1. Optimize for Questions, Not Just Keywords

Content must anticipate natural-language queries like:

  • “How much does it cost to hire a DUI attorney in Miami?”
  • “Best neighborhoods in South Florida for first-time homebuyers”

Use these questions as headings and answer them clearly in 1–2 paragraphs. Add them to your blog content, service pages, and FAQs.

2. Use Structured Data and Schema Markup

Schema helps Google understand your content and display it as part of an SGE response or featured snippet. Use:

  • FAQ Schema
  • How-To Schema
  • LocalBusiness Schema
  • Review Schema

3. Build Topical Authority

Instead of publishing isolated blog posts, build clusters around key services. For example, a Coral Gables real estate agency might build a hub on “Buying Your First Home in Miami” with subtopics like:

  • “Top 5 Miami Neighborhoods for Families”
  • “Step-by-Step Guide to Closing in South Florida”
  • “What First-Time Buyers Should Know About Florida Property Taxes”

Interlink them to boost relevance and signal depth to search engines.

4. Add Real-World Experience to Content

SGE pulls from sites that show real-world experience. Include:

  • Case studies
  • Quotes from team members
  • Client testimonials
  • Specific examples based on local scenarios

This helps Google view your content as authoritative and trustworthy.
